Did Qatar Bribe Ecuador ahead of their opening Match?

Nov 17, 2022 | Local News

November 17, 2022

BARRIO – Problems continue to build up in Qatar. Reports are surfacing about host country Qatar bribing its opponents.

According to Amjad Taha, the regional director of the British Middle East Center for Studies and Research with over 430,000 followers on Twitter, Qatar has bribed opposing players. According to Taha and other insiders, Qatar bribed eight Ecuadorian players $7.4 million to lose the opening game of the tournament.

Taha also claims that the bribe involves Qatar winning the match 1-0 with the lone goal coming in the second half.

FIFA is super concerned about match-fixing. It’s expected that over $100 billion in bets will be made throughout the tournament.
